// Compression tradeoffs for the Skerry gateway websockets.
// Per-message deflate is enabled; context takeover is off to
// bound per-connection memory. Small frames bypass compression
// to limit oracle-style leakage on attacker-influenced payloads.
// Reviewer: verify thresholds below against the threat model.
// The tuning constants follow.

tuning table, yajog-yahof:
BUDGETS = {
    "lamvan": 303,
    "wenox": 460,
    "fenvan": 525,
}

Ticket QV-812 — Replace homegrown job queue

Plan: retire the legacy Brickmill queue and migrate to the Oakrun scheduler. Impact on plugin authors: the enqueue API keeps its shape, but retry semantics change — max 5 attempts, exponential backoff, no infinite retries. Deprecated: priority hints above level 3. Migration window: next minor release; legacy shim removed two releases later. Plugins relying on queue internals must update before cutover. Status: blocked pending sign-off. Sign-off required from the person named below.

account owner for fajep-faweg: Jorwyn Rusok Zorath Norius

## Vendor Note: Telemetry Payload Compression

Starting with SDK v4, all plugin telemetry sent to the MeterHaven collector must be compressed with zstd (level 3 recommended). Uncompressed payloads over 64KB will be rejected. Please update your pipelines before the cutover date announced in the partner bulletin. Questions about the compression spec should go to the integrations desk below.

escalation mailbox, bafog-fafog: ulador@paliqlabs.internal

**Q: Why do deleted orders still appear in Cartheon reports?**

Soft deletes. Rows in the orders table get a deleted_at timestamp; they are never removed. Support should filter on that column before escalating. Hard purges run quarterly. To inspect soft-deleted rows directly, you need the audit vault, which stays locked by default. Open it with the recovery passphrase below.

vault phrase of kawep-tahog = ulaix-briath